impress.js
It's a presentation framework based on the power of CSS3 transforms and transitions in modern browsers and inspired by the idea behind prezi.com. (by impress)
Owl Carousel 2
DEPRECATED jQuery Responsive Carousel. (by OwlCarousel2)

Does anyone have a favorite (and accessible) JS-based presentation library?
I've looked at impress.js and reveal.js. Impress feels a little dated to me (very Prezzi-like) and not very accessible if I wanted to hand out the url.

carousel on grid elements by using bootstrap only
I do not believe bootstrap has a build in carousel method. In past projects, I usually use the owl carousel library. It used jQuery so it falls inline with the existing bootstrap js methods and it also allows you to group items.
